Scala 2.10带来了除了提供JVM(或者我猜CLR)之外的反射.
我们还有什么特别值得期待的,它将如何在平台上得到改善?
例如,是否会有一个类反映语言在字段和访问器方法之间的可转换性,以便我可以迭代对象的属性?
我正在将Java对象传递给视图:
我不知道是否有可能将对象的所有字段都作为集合(类似于Java中的反射)然后在循环中打印它们而不是列出所有字段,如下所示:
@(item: Item)
<li data-item-id="@item.id">
<h4>@item.name</h4>
<h3>@item.field1</h3>
<h3>@item.field2</h3>
...
</li>
Run Code Online (Sandbox Code Playgroud)
第二个问题是什么HTML标签是最相关的(而不是li,h4,h3)表示对象?